1. What is minimalism? Where does it come from?
The term minimalist means "simplify to the maximum", it is an artistic movement that uses basic elements such as neutral colors, and it originated from the exuberance of fashion in the 1960s in New York. This decor style influences architecture and art, but also fashion and music.

This style involves removing unnecessary elements in decoration to bring things to life through the simplicity and order that this design implies, giving great importance to space.
Much more than bedroom or living room decor, minimalism is a state of mind. A desire to find a relaxing environment? The wish for a simpler life? To support small artisans and work coming from true know-how? Take the step into minimalism!
2. What are the characteristics of minimalism?
To create a minimalist environment, it is not necessary to throw away all your belongings and start over; just observe and eliminate elements that have no reason to be in the house, clear the clutter by putting everything back in its place but out of sight, and replace old bulky furniture with simpler pieces.
A. Colors
One of the main features of minimalism is the use of simple colors. The predominant soft tones are white and ecru. Black is also incorporated with subtle touches of color to accentuate details and accessories.

Wood is used for both floors and furniture: smooth cement, glass, steel wire, and stone, mainly in its natural state. For wall colors, go for solid light colors.

B. Furniture & decorative objects
For furniture, it is preferable to choose furniture with straight and simple lines, no frills. Robust vintage seats and armchairs blend perfectly into this philosophy.

For decorative objects, there is a huge choice despite the very simple spirit of the movement. Minerals such as amethyst, pyrite, and quartz are perfect stones for this. Also, dried flowers and bouquets of dried plants and flowers are an excellent way to bring a colorful touch to your living room.

Scandinavian decoration, a cozy and trendy decor
Scandinavian decoration is an interesting blend of Old World and New World design. It focuses on simple, elegant, and rustic styles, often with elements of art and craftsmanship.
Color is another element you will need to pay attention to when decorating your home with a Nordic spirit. The colors you choose for your rooms should harmonize or complement each other, rather than clash.
1. What are the secrets of a successful Nordic decor?
One of the keys to Nordic decoration is to create spaces marked by harmony and tranquility. This goal is achieved through neutral and calm colors, to which a particular arrangement is given to each element such as furniture, decorative objects, and lighting.

Another aspect of this proposal concerns the union with the natural world. The main source of inspiration for creating a home with this type of decoration must be nature, so the star material of this decorative movement is none other than wood. We must also talk about simplicity, more precisely, the simplicity of shapes, in line with minimalism. Furniture and design objects have soft and light shapes, creating a refined and natural style.

The first thing we need to know is that minimalism is closely linked to Scandinavian decoration. The search for simplicity and functionality must be considered as a whole, not just in furniture choice. And, as we said, light tones take on their full importance. However, dynamism and color are not left out but are introduced in small accessories with intense colors.
2. What is the “Hygge” style?
The concept of "Hygge" means "Happiness." It is more of a lifestyle, a philosophy, inviting you to savor the little pleasures of daily life. And what better place to do that than at home. Beyond aesthetics and functionality, decoration can also evoke sensations and influence your mood.
In this constant search for happiness, hygge decoration proposes creating warm, relaxing, and comfortable spaces, environments where you can forget your stressful daily life. Will you dare to be happier?

Once again, neutral colors are the key to decorating your home. They are warm, relaxing, bright, and create balanced atmospheres. An oasis of peace in your own home.
Here too, natural elements are important. Materials such as wood, stones, or plants and fabrics like wool or linen bring warmth to spaces, making them more welcoming. Less is more. If Nordic decor bets on minimalism, hygge decor does too. Opt for simplicity and don't overload the rooms.
